Houses

When hunting for Batchewana houses for rent, focus on lot size, driveway and parking, and proximity to transit or major routes. Detached houses and semi-detached homes often come with more outdoor space and storage, so prioritizing must-have features like yard maintenance, shed access, or garage parking will help narrow options quickly.

Inspect the property carefully for heating, insulation, and seasonal readiness — Canadian winters make heating efficiency and window condition important. Confirm who is responsible for yard care, snow removal, and major repairs in the lease, and ask about average utility costs to compare total monthly housing expenses accurately.

Condos

Batchewana condos for rent often appeal to renters seeking lower maintenance and built-in amenities. When evaluating condo units, check condo rules around short-term rentals, renovations, and common area use; some strata or condo boards limit renters’ activities or guest policies.

Factor in condo fees and what they cover — heat, water, building insurance, or parking may be included, which can simplify budgeting. Confirm visitor parking, storage availability, and any building access features that affect daily routines, such as elevator reliability or package delivery procedures.

Townhomes

Townhomes blend the privacy of a house with the convenience of a condo; they’re a popular choice for families and professionals seeking more square footage without high maintenance. For Batchewana townhomes for rent, evaluate shared wall soundproofing, layout flow, and outdoor space ownership or maintenance responsibilities.

Ask about parking allocation, visitor parking, and whether any exterior maintenance is shared with neighbours. Clarify lease clauses on alterations and subletting, and verify proximity to schools, parks, and shopping to ensure the townhome fits your lifestyle needs.

Frequently Asked Questions

What documents are typically required for a rental application?

Most landlords request a government photo ID, recent pay stubs or proof of income, a rental history or references, and a credit check consent. Prepare digital copies of these documents and a short cover letter explaining employment stability or any special circumstances to strengthen your Batchewana rental application.

How long are typical lease terms for rentals in Batchewana?

Lease terms commonly run for one year, but six-month or month-to-month arrangements are sometimes available depending on the landlord’s needs. Discuss renewal procedures and any rent review timelines before signing so you understand notice requirements and options for extending the tenancy.

Can rent be increased during a lease, and how much notice is required?

Rent increases during a fixed lease are usually not permitted until the lease term ends, after which landlords may apply an increase with appropriate notice as governed by provincial regulations. Always review the lease for rent-increase clauses and confirm the notice period for renewal offers or changes to monthly rent.

Which utilities are typically included, and what should I budget for separately?

In some rentals, heat, water, or building services may be included; in others, tenants pay for hydro, internet, and heating. Ask the landlord for average monthly utility costs for the unit to calculate total monthly housing expenses, and confirm who is responsible for any municipal fees or recycling charges.

Are pets usually allowed in Batchewana rentals?

Pet policies vary by landlord and by building — condos may have stricter rules while private houses are often more flexible. Disclose pets early, provide references or records for well-behaved animals, and discuss any pet deposits or extra cleaning fees so there are no surprises when you move in.

What should I expect during a move-in inspection and routine inspections?

Conduct a thorough move-in inspection with the landlord and document the condition of walls, appliances, flooring, and fixtures to avoid disputes at move-out. Routine inspections may be scheduled with notice; landlords should provide fair notice and conduct inspections for maintenance verification rather than frequent intrusion.
